What companies run services between Chichester, England and Gatwick Stream, England?
Southern operates a train from Chichester to Gatwick Airport twice daily. Tickets cost £8–40 and the journey takes 1h 10m. Alternatively, National Express operates a bus from Market to North Terminal Bus Station every 2 hours. Tickets cost £6–19 and the journey takes 1h 15m.
